Mariners a win from first World Series, beat Blue Jays behind Suárez’s grand slam for 3-2 ALCS lead
Suárez hit a go-ahead grand slam after Cal Raleigh’s tying drive in a five-run eighth inning, giving the Mariners a 6-2 win over the Toronto Blue Jays on Friday and a 3-2 lead in the American League Championship Series.

The Mariners cannot clinch the pennant at the corner of Edgar & Dave. Their first two flops here dashed those hopes. If they play again in Seattle this year, it will be in the World Series. Like the hero of Game 5, they got back up just in time.
An announced sellout crowd of 46,981 came to T-Mobile Park, anticipating the Mariners would take a 3-1 series lead. When first baseman Josh Naylor hit a solo homer in the second inning, the bitter aftertaste of Wednesday’s 13-4 loss turned into fresh hope that this night would end happily.
